Output dae8baf2aae31d7c79fd2ff72e5123040646191ac429c17cda13a65de0f3cbd5:18

value
21536255
script pubkey
OP_HASH160 OP_PUSHBYTES_20 68f35ea1da90449e84c5533a64977e117b9d6dbe OP_EQUAL
address
MHU63zzsdz8kC1yzMqEh3Y4YDk1yx1vm2U
transaction
dae8baf2aae31d7c79fd2ff72e5123040646191ac429c17cda13a65de0f3cbd5
spent
true